Scope:
The Solutions Architect CRM supports the delivery of the
OPGT Modernization program by providing technical leadership for Microsoft
Dynamics 365. The role is responsible for:
- Defining and maintaining the end-to-end technical
architecture across application, data, and integration domains.
- Ensuring all configurations and customizations align with
OPS enterprise architecture and security standards.
- Leading the design of complex integrations between Dynamics
365, internal legacy systems, and Azure data platforms.
- Mentoring the development team and reviewing technical
designs to ensure scalability and maintainability.
Assignment Deliverables:
- Architecture Design Artifacts: Detailed conceptual, logical,
and physical models for D365 processes and data structures.
- Integration Strategy: Design and implementation oversight
for interfaces using Azure Integration Services and Data Factory.
- Governance Documentation: Preparation and presentation of
materials for the OPS Architectural Review Board (ARB) and Cyber Security
Assessments.
- Deployment & CI/CD Strategy: Establishing robust version
control and automated build/release pipelines.

What you need to know about the Toronto Tech Scene
Although home to some of the biggest names in tech, including Google, Microsoft and Amazon, Toronto has established itself as one of the largest startup ecosystems in the world. And with over 2,000 startups — more than 30 percent of the country's total startups — Toronto continues to attract new businesses. Be it helping entrepreneurs manage their finances, simplifying business operations by automating payroll or assisting pharmaceutical companies in launching new drugs, the city's tech scene is just getting started.
